Lavolea 2024 Olive Washing Machine
The LAVOLEA 2024 is Rapanelli’s olive washing machine, designed to remove foreign bodies and impurities from the fruit before it reaches the crusher. Olives enter through a loading hopper and go through a two-stage process: sedimentation and screening to remove heavy debris and leaves, followed by a final rinse with potable water.
An integrated settling tank and filtering circuit allow process water to be recirculated, reducing water consumption and operating costs across the harvest.

Engineering Highlights
The engineering layout of the LAVOLEA 2024 focuses on cleaning consistency, water efficiency, and ease of integration into the reception line. Key technical features include:
- loading hopper feeding a two-stage washing process
- sedimentation system with extraction screw for stones and soil
- vibrating screen for leaves and light impurities
- final rinse stage using potable water
- integrated settling tank with filtering circuit for water recirculation
- product-contact surfaces in AISI304 stainless steel
Every machine is supplied with the electrical control box and a three-phase 400V connection.

How the Washing Process Works
In the first stage, olives are immersed in water. Heavy foreign bodies, stones and soil, sink and are removed through a sedimentation system with an extraction screw, while leaves and light impurities are separated by a vibrating screen.
In the second stage, a final rinse with potable water completes decontamination of the fruit before it enters the mill.
